**Ticket: Config drift on BounceSift processor**

The email bounce processor in the Larkfield environment has drifted from the values committed in the release branch. Retry windows and suppression thresholds no longer match, which likely explains the duplicate suppression entries reported Tuesday. Please reconcile before the Thursday cut. For reference, the currently deployed configuration on the live node reads as follows.

config for yajep-yahof:
[briax]
port = 9200
region = outer-2
host = briax.nelvrocorp.test
team = raleth
timeout_ms = 1500
retries = 1

## Authentication

Welcome to the Quillmark FX team! Our conversion service rounds at the final step, not per-line-item, so don't panic if staging totals drift by a cent — that's tracked in the Penny Drift epic. To poke the rates endpoint yourself, you'll need to authenticate every request. Use the staging token below in your Authorization header.

portal login ticket: eyJhbGciOiJIUzI1NiIsInR5cCI6IkpXVCJ9.eyJzdWIiOiIwEOsktwVNwIn0.-UJU3fdyyCgG

The marketing budget cut approved last quarter reduces annual spend by 3.1 million credits, phased over three tranches. I have documented the affected cost centres, the revised accrual schedule, and the vendor contracts flagged for renegotiation, particularly the Starfen media retainer. Teo will own reporting from March. Please review reconciliations carefully before each tranche closes. The underlying business rationale is set out in the confidential note below.

management briefing: Project Ulavan slips by two quarters because of the staffing delay.

## Deployment

The Lumacache image service has a known slow leak in its thumbnail cache layer: evicted entries keep a reference alive through the decoder pool, so resident memory creeps up roughly 40 MB per hour under steady load. Until the refactor in the Harkness branch lands, we mitigate by capping pool size and scheduling a rolling restart every 12 hours. Deploy with the supervisor, never bare, or the restart hook won't fire. The deployment relies on the configuration values listed below.

settings of bagug-tahof:
holath:
  pin: 7837
  metrics_host: metrics.holath.tolvaqsys.internal
  tenant: quenath
  seal: seal_6001b3af